A large clip-lock box in a camo bag, hidden in a hedgerow in south-east Oswestry.
This cache was created as a handy place for me to drop off travel bugs and geocoins that I have picked up in London, but hopefully local cachers will also like to use it if they have any items that they would like to travel to the capital.
The cache is hidden in a hedgerow just a short distance along Middleton Lane in south-east Oswestry. It's best to park at the bottom of Middleton Road (near Weavers Close) as Middleton Lane is restricted to residents' vehicles only. If you would like to walk further along the lane, there is an interesting pond to be seen in Eaton Field.
The cache should be an easy find, but please be careful to watch out for dog-walking muggles and to ensure that the cache is tucked away out of general view!
